January is Readiness for Change Month

The beginning of a new year is the perfect time to begin to make changes toward a more healthy lifestyle. Setting goals can help you chart your path to a successful and healthier 2019.
There are 2 types of goals: long-term and short-term. A long-term goal is something that you want to accomplish in the future and takes a long time to achieve. Short-term goals are things that you want to accomplish in the near future. Short-term goals help you accomplish your long-term goals.
Here are some tips for setting and reaching your health goals:
- Write down your long-term and short-term goals
- Make sure your goals are specific
- Track your progress to help you stay motivated
- Update you goals as you move forward
- Focus on small goals one at a time
- When you reach a goal, reward yourself before setting the next one
- Prepare for setbacks so you know how to deal with them and remain positive
- Get support from friends, family, support groups, or a professional
